Résumé
This paper concerns the use of food waste as the organic component of a highly successful biological plant fertilizer ( Leggo, 2017 ). The original plant fertilizer consists of a mixture of chicken manure and crushed rock having an abundance of clinoptilolite zeolite. This paper concerns the use of a machine to digested food waste that can replace the chicken manure. Converted to a liquid digestate, self - maintained, microbially, at a minimum temperature of 70o C . After one hour the mixture is self - pasteurised, ensuring, the liquid safe to handle. A plant fertilizer results which is friable and easy to mix with soil. As the mixing ratio is five parts soil to one part fertilizer, its use is commercially viable. Use of food waste in this way, is most desirable as otherwise it would be disposed without any benefit
